Output 595711dd95366f9d2ed6fc410f512e23dd5cdae60f973cf7dfd48ff7114f42b2:0

value
2798000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d489ce379617d7c4a78ae415a7b70552402cb9c OP_EQUAL
address
3QnFsJh6DcrG4qDPjAcCDHdYCuQAnbEApA
transaction
595711dd95366f9d2ed6fc410f512e23dd5cdae60f973cf7dfd48ff7114f42b2
spent
true